#4900cc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4900cc is composed of 28.6% red, 0% green and 80%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64.2% cyan, 100% magenta, 0% yellow and 20% black. It has a hue angle of 261.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 40%. #4900cc color hex could be obtained by blending #9200ff with #000099.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

Shades and Tints of #4900cc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030008 is the darkest color, while #f7f3ff is the lightest one.
